More2017-2-7 Production lines are used both in batch production and mass production. Batch production involves moving a set of items through each step together as a batch. For example, a bakery may process 1200 donuts a step at a time moving the donuts together from workstation to workstation. Afterwards, the production line may be reconfigured for a batch ...

More2017-2-7 Production line is a broad term that can include manufacturing processes that don't involve parts. For example, a food factory may use a production line to apply a series of food processing and packaging steps.Assembly line is specific to production lines that assemble something by adding parts and components in a series of steps.

MoreSemiconductor manufacturing process : Hitachi High-Tech GLOBAL. 1. Semiconductor manufacturing process. A semiconductor chip is an electric circuit with many components such as transistors and wiring formed on a semiconductor wafer. An electronic device comprising numerous these components is called “ integrated circuit (IC) ”.

More2014-8-19 Various lean manufacturing tools have been applied to make improvements in the productivity and reliability of the production process. Methods such as Total Productive Maintenance (TPM), launched by Nakajima (1988), have been implemented by many firms to maintain and improve the integrity of the production line.

More2021-8-11 The most common feature of this assembly line was the conveyer belt. The belts were in use within other industries, including slaughterhouses. Moving the product to the worker seemed like a better use of time and resources. The Ford Motor Company team decided to try to implement the moving assembly line in the automobile manufacturing process.

Line-Flow Process As with intermittent processes line-flow processes also are frequently subdivided into two processes assembly line and continuous Assembly line processes manufacture individual discrete products Examples here include electronic products such as VCRs and CD players as well as automobiles and kitchen appliances.
